NVPC Staff Training on Scoping SBV Projects

Client: National Volunteer and Philanthropy Centre (NVPC)


The Work Involved

In 2025, NVPC partnered with Empact to upskill their staff in scoping skills-based volunteering (SBV) projects with corporate partners. These SBV projects are intended to support organisational development challenges among charities and social enterprises.  The objective of the upskilling sessions is to address key challenges that staff face during the partner engagements, thereby improving their effectiveness and success in future engagements.

​

The scope of work included:

  • Design skills-based volunteering project scoping material to equip participants in addressing challenges encountered during engagement of corporate partners 

  • Guide participants to make connections with existing training assets to optimise their learning effectiveness

  • Conduct in-person training sessions that include case scenario discussion segments & cohort shareback to encourage diverse perspectives while reinforcing the learnings

​

Results of our work 

Up to 20 staff benefited from the in-person trainings. They were able to apply their newly gained insights to projects in a timely manner, especially for staff who are account managers with existing and pipeline projects.
